WATCH: PSU Takes Lead on TD by ‘Fatman’

Kaytron Allen celebrates his first quarter touchdown.

UNIVERSITY PARK– Penn State got off to a slow start but is now starting to get in rhythm. PSU has scored the game’s last 10 points and now leads Rutgers, 10-3. 

Penn State’s first six points came on a two-yard Kaytron Allen run. 

On the ensuing Rutgers possession, QB Gavin Wimsatt fumbled, and PSU DE Dani Dennis-Sutton recovered it, setting Penn State up at the Rutgers 32. 

PSU failed to score a touchdown off that turnover but did add on with an Alex Felkins field goal.
